N357CF is a 1979 Piper PA-44-180. It is a fixed-wing multi-engine aircraft with 4 seats, powered by a Lycoming O-360-E1A6D rated at 180 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in San Diego, CA.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Nov 2021. It has been registered to its current owner since Oct 2020.
